Programs for Moms and Grandmothers

2013_Photos moms and children-24 (1) MUA offers a series of workshops that focus on developing healthier relationships between parents and children. These workshops are designed to support parents and grandparents, as well as women caring for young children. Often, as parents, we isolate ourselves from our problems by believing that we are the only ones having a difficult time with our children. Through our workshops (adapted from the Hand in Hand Parenting curriculum) we share information that is helpful in understanding children, identifying when our children may need help, and how to ask for help when we need it. Participants have the opportunity to talk about their own experiences and knowledge, as well as develop strategies to address current problems they may be having. The main objective of the workshops is to help us become more confident in our ability to create a healthy and stimulating environment for the development and growth of our children. (Due to the pandemic MUA does not offer these programs at the moment)

MUA offers an on-site child care program during all meetings, workshops and trainings that are attended by members of our community who have been trained as child care providers. Our child care program is an opportunity for our members' children to connect with their culture, learn and participate in social movements, and develop healthy relationships.

MUA also offers family programs, such as “Family Nights,” which bring members and children together to celebrate Latino culture and be proud of being bilingual and bicultural. We create community celebrations throughout the year for our members and their families.
